In youth, people tend to overestimate their strength. As said the humorist, the man can do everything while he does nothing. What does that mean? Man somehow represents yourself, your strengths and capabilities, and until they are stretched to the limit - this limit does not see, not feel, and only knows that the supply of his strength allows him to move on, to do more. But when he was growing up, facing increasing obstacles, he finds a limit. That is: he is not so much overestimating how many underestimates haven't tried or even unknown obstacles.
